Job description

Position: POS Engineer
Duration: 8+ months
Location: Boston Support Center, MA (4 days onsite)
Must Have(s):
  1. 5 years high volume POS engineering experience
  2. 3 years edge computing in large scale environment
  3. 5 years POS hardware experience
  4. 1 year Oracle Symphony & Oracle Res

Contract | Individual Contributor
What This Role Is
We are hiring a hands-on senior consultant to help design and evaluate next-generation POS hardware and edge computing architecture for a large Quick Service Restaurant (QSR) environment as part of a team. The position is an onsite role in our Canton, MA support center.
This is not a people-manager role and not day-to-day POS support.
The focus is architecture, tradeoffs, and future-proofing-especially extending hardware life, reducing OS risk, and ensuring systems can grow with software (including AI use cases) over the next 5-10 years.
What You'll Do
• Evaluate current POS hardware and deployment models
• Evaluate edge-based architectures that:
o Reduce dependency on POS terminal OS EOS
o Allow POS logic to move off the register where appropriate
o Support 100% seamless offline operation and high-volume store environments
• Help define where workloads should run:
o POS endpoint vs store edge vs cloud
• Assess hardware and OS choices against future growth, including AI-driven workloads
• Deliver clear architecture recommendations, diagrams, and tradeoff analysis with the team
Required Experience (Must Have)
POS & QSR Experience
• Hands-on experience with large enterprise POS systems in QSR or high-volume retail
• Strong understanding of:
o Transactions
o Payments
o Peripherals
o Offline / degraded network behavior
• Experience designing around existing POS platforms, not replacing them
Edge Computing & Architecture
• Real experience designing or operating edge computing in distributed environments
• Comfortable with store-level compute models that work even when the network is down
• Experience supporting mixed fleets (legacy hardware + new stores)
POS Hardware
• Experience with enterprise POS hardware such as:
o NCR
o Oracle MICROS
o HP (or similar vendors)
• Understands hardware lifecycle realities (long refresh cycles, mixed environments)
OS & Imaging (Hands-On)
• OS imaging and lifecycle management experience
Windows LTSC in POS environments (including tradeoffs)
Linux for edge or backend workloads (practical use, not ideological)
Future-Ready & Capacity Planning (Critical)
• Understands how emerging technologies (e.g., AI, real-time analytics, automation) impact store compute needs
• Experience with capacity planning and technology decisions looking 3-5 years out
• Able to design architectures where software growth does not immediately force hardware upgrades
We are not looking for someone to build AI models-
we are looking for someone who understands what AI and future software demand from infrastructure.
What This Role Is NOT
• Not people management
• Not vendor ownership or procurement negotiation
• Not day-to-day POS support or store operations
• Not an AI engineering role
Ideal Candidate Summary
A senior individual contributor with deep POS and QSR experience who can combine edge computing, OS strategy, and capacity planning to deliver practical, future-ready POS architecture recommendations-without forcing unnecessary hardware refreshes.
